Optimism isn’t just a mindset—it’s a skill you can practice and grow.
In this episode of Let’s Talk Love, Robin sits down with psychiatrist, author, and mental health advocate Dr. Sue Varma to explore the power of Practical Optimism.
Drawing from her new book Practical Optimism: The Art, Science, and Practice of Exceptional Well-Being, Dr. Varma shares how optimism isn’t a fixed trait, it’s a skill we can all learn. Together, they unpack the eight pillars of practical optimism, the importance of processing emotions, and how meaningful relationships support our mental and emotional health.
Through personal stories and research-backed insights, this conversation offers a grounded, compassionate approach to building emotional strength and staying connected to hope—even when life feels uncertain.
